If you have been driving a car for some time, you understand that different skills are needed for different driving conditions. The more driving you do, the smarter you become in ensuring the safety of your passengers as well as the other drivers on the road. It is quite evident when weather conditions change that you need to be more aware of what may occur on the road. Nonetheless, driving at night is also an area that requires certain skills and precautions. This article is going to concentrate on driving at night and ways to be safe. The primary thing to consider if you want to stay safe when driving at night is to look at your own driving patterns and what time of the day you are usually on the road. If you drive primarily during the day, you may need to be more cautious if you drive at night to places you don’t ordinarily go. It is also essential that you know your own health circumstance since night driving could be affected by poor health. As an example, in the event your eyesight is starting to diminish, your ability to see at night will become more difficult.

Apart from your own health condition, you need to be conscious of your car as well. It’s always important that other drivers notice you in good time, especially in threatening conditions, so make sure you check all of your lights are in good working order. This includes lights that one doesn’t normally use such as fog lights. The tires must be examined and replaced when necessary since the icy winter months can be dangerous when driving at night.

Often there is the chance that you will break down while travelling at some point and if this happens at night, you will want to have certain things with you to ensure you stay safe and can get home. Aside from having roadside assistance, it’s also wise to have some items in your car in case of emergency. You should have an emergency kit that features something to keep you warm, has a warning triangle to ensure that other drivers know that you are there.

You should utilize your common sense and make sure that you drive at a lower speed and keep your distance when driving at night. If this appears like something bad is about to happen, at least you have some time to react. When you follow the advice, you should have a very low risk time driving at night.

Pricing an interior design project is very tricky. If you are looking for a top notch designer to make some changes inside your home, you may be confused about what it should cost. This often leads to concerns that a particular interior designer is overcharging for a given project, which is why most people end up getting several different competitive quotes before awarding their job to one designer. You will find that different designers have different costs as well as different expertise and levels of skill. The exact specifications of your job and the materials to be used will also cause the price to fluctuate some.

There are five basic ways in which a designer can charge their client. The first way in which they can charge is by an hourly rate. A lot of people that are hiring a designer dread the hourly rate, and this is very understandable. Some designers could take a while to do a project whereas others could do them fairly quickly.

There are some designers that are willing to set a cap on the total amount that they will charge, or will agree to a set number of hours to complete the work. Before you sign a capped agreement it is very important to be aware of what will happen once the maximum is reached. The hourly rate is the fairest way to charge for consultations rather than the complete designer services.

Some designers will prefer to work on a commission or percentage basis. In the case of a commission, you will be paying them a particular percentage of all of the required materials for the job. This is a great set-up for designers and is preferred by many. Others prefer to just receive a percentage of your available budget. In this case you need to make sure you completely understand how the percentage is being taken and exactly how much the project could cost you overall.

Every now and then you may come across a designer who wants to charge by the square foot, but this pricing method is not used very often. When it is used it tends to be for larger projects. Most clients are now asking for one flat fee which takes all the guesswork out of getting your interior design projects completed. Paying one fee which is agreed upon before the work begins is the best way to go if you have an option, since you don’t have to worry about how high the price could soar by the end of the project.

No matter what type of pricing agreement you enter into, you can expect your designer to require at deposit at the time you sign the contract. In many cases this deposit will be around 15% of the total or estimated cost of the project. This is standard in the industry.

There are some designers that will request as much as fifty per cent as a deposit. It is very uncommon for a deposit to be requested for a consultation. When you are hiring a designer it is very important to remember that designers will have different methods for billing clients.

Expert Tips For A Basement Wall Finishing Project

December 15th, 2011 1 comment

Finishing a basement wall is not exactly like working on a wall above ground. First of all, it is never a good idea to drive nails into concrete or concrete block in a basement. They have enough of a tendency to admit moisture without making holes in them. Secondly, they should be so constructed as to protect wooden interiors from any moisture that does get in. For best results in basement wall finishing, try these simple steps.

1. Determine what the basement will be used for; if you want a formal basement, the finishing will obviously have to be of better quality, whereas a basement being used for laundry or storage does not need to be perfectly finished. There should be no seepage or higher than permitted radon levels in a basement that will be used as living space.

2. Note any problems with leaking and fix them first. A good way to guard against moisture is to coat the concrete with waterproof paint. Doing this is a good idea whether or not you have ever had problems with water seepage.

3. Once you are ready to start, attach rigid foam insulation material to the wall’s interior, and this should be done in stages, rather than all at once.

4. Firing strips should then be attached to the insulation, so that the concrete and wood do not touch each other, and so that moisture cannot damage the furring strips. Pressure heated strips can also be used for additional security.

5. Install any additional plumbing, electrical or telecommunications lines. In most cases the lines are already present in a basement and can be modified at no great expense. Homeowners who are not very confident of their skills should consider hiring a professional to plumbing and particularly electrical work.

6. Finish the walls with drywall. Consider using drywall designed to be water resistant in basement applications.

7. Paint, paper and install switch covers. Make sure your design allows for the generally low light levels in basements. Using bright or light colors and allowing for plentiful lighting is the best guarantee of basement that is pleasant to use.

If you really want to add living space to a home, consider finishing a basement wall, which is a fairly easy and inexpensive task for any homeowner. However, it is important to use practices and techniques which are suitable for underground construction and you should also take into account the existing conditions in the basement. The finished project can help to add value to your home, as well as increasing your living space, or making much needed space for storage, a games room or a workshop.

There are various kinds of measuring tapes. On the standard measuring tape, the subdivisions of the foot are inches, while the inches themselves are subdivided by factors of four, usually 1/16 or 1/32 inch, and also the larger units of 1/4 and 1/2 inch. This can be enough for simple measurements, however making calculations with values more than 1 foot needs changing those dimensions into inches first. With an engineering measuring tape, the foot is not divided into inches, rather into tenths, or larger factors of ten, just like 1/20. 1/30, 1/50 or 1/60. Using this type of measuring tape, values higher than 1 foot could be multiplied without first changing the value to a different unit, particularly in the case of tenths of a foot. 1 1/2 feet multiplied by 2 can be stated as 1.5 multiplied by 2, which is equivalent to three feet.
